  • Abstract
    PVC supported membranes of polyaniline–titanium(IV)phosphate (PANI–TiP) cation exchange nanocomposite were prepared by solution casting method in different stoichiometric ratios of PVC and PANI–TiP. The structure and morphology of the prepared membrane were ascertained by FTIR, SEM and TGA–DTA. The membrane having a composition 1:1 (PVC:PANI–TiP) shows best results for electrical conductivity, water content, porosity, thickness and swelling. The Pb(II) selective electrode was developed by using this membrane for the determination of lead in solutions. The membrane electrode was mechanically stable, having wide dynamic range, with quick response time and could be operated for at least 5 months.
